'$2y$12$6iyKwObB3zokmhwUuBhXxuB3/ZenHS4aosToHJJK0Yl3JgY1S80sy',
);
// Readonly users
// e.g. array('users', 'guest', ...)
$readonly_users = array(
'user'
);
// Global readonly, including when auth is not being used
$global_readonly = false;
// user specific directories
// array('Username' => 'Directory path', 'Username2' => 'Directory path', ...)
$directories_users = array();
// Enable highlight.js (https://highlightjs.org/) on view's page
$use_highlightjs = true;
// highlight.js style
// for dark theme use 'ir-black'
$highlightjs_style = 'vs';
// Enable ace.js (https://ace.c9.io/) on view's page
$edit_files = true;
// Default timezone for date() and time()
// Doc - http://php.net/manual/en/timezones.php
$default_timezone = 'Etc/UTC'; // UTC
// Root path for file manager
// use absolute path of directory i.e: '/var/www/folder' or $_SERVER['DOCUMENT_ROOT'].'/folder'
$root_path = $_SERVER['DOCUMENT_ROOT'];
// Root url for links in file manager.Relative to $http_host. Variants: '', 'path/to/subfolder'
// Will not working if $root_path will be outside of server document root
$root_url = '';
// Server hostname. Can set manually if wrong
// $_SERVER['HTTP_HOST'].'/folder'
$http_host = $_SERVER['HTTP_HOST'];
// input encoding for iconv
$iconv_input_encoding = 'UTF-8';
// date() format for file modification date
// Doc - https://www.php.net/manual/en/function.date.php
$datetime_format = 'm/d/Y g:i A';
// Path display mode when viewing file information
// 'full' => show full path
// 'relative' => show path relative to root_path
// 'host' => show path on the host
$path_display_mode = 'full';
// Allowed file extensions for create and rename files
// e.g. 'txt,html,css,js'
$allowed_file_extensions = '';
// Allowed file extensions for upload files
// e.g. 'gif,png,jpg,html,txt'
$allowed_upload_extensions = '';
// Favicon path. This can be either a full url to an .PNG image, or a path based on the document root.
// full path, e.g http://example.com/favicon.png
// local path, e.g images/icons/favicon.png
$favicon_path = '';
// Files and folders to excluded from listing
// e.g. array('myfile.html', 'personal-folder', '*.php', ...)
$exclude_items = array();
// Online office Docs Viewer
// Availabe rules are 'google', 'microsoft' or false
// Google => View documents using Google Docs Viewer
// Microsoft => View documents using Microsoft Web Apps Viewer
// false => disable online doc viewer
$online_viewer = 'google';
// Sticky Nav bar
// true => enable sticky header
// false => disable sticky header
$sticky_navbar = true;
// Maximum file upload size
// Increase the following values in php.ini to work properly
// memory_limit, upload_max_filesize, post_max_size
$max_upload_size_bytes = 5000000000; // size 5,000,000,000 bytes (~5GB)
// chunk size used for upload
// eg. decrease to 1MB if nginx reports problem 413 entity too large
$upload_chunk_size_bytes = 2000000; // chunk size 2,000,000 bytes (~2MB)
// Possible rules are 'OFF', 'AND' or 'OR'
// OFF => Don't check connection IP, defaults to OFF
// AND => Connection must be on the whitelist, and not on the blacklist
// OR => Connection must be on the whitelist, or not on the blacklist
$ip_ruleset = 'OFF';
// Should users be notified of their block?
$ip_silent = true;
// IP-addresses, both ipv4 and ipv6
$ip_whitelist = array(
'127.0.0.1', // local ipv4
'::1' // local ipv6
);
// IP-addresses, both ipv4 and ipv6
$ip_blacklist = array(
'0.0.0.0', // non-routable meta ipv4
'::' // non-routable meta ipv6
);
// if User has the external config file, try to use it to override the default config above [config.php]
// sample config - https://tinyfilemanager.github.io/config-sample.txt
$config_file = __DIR__.'/config.php';
if (is_readable($config_file)) {
@include($config_file);
}
// External CDN resources that can be used in the HTML (replace for GDPR compliance)
$external = array(
'css-bootstrap' => '',
'css-dropzone' => '',
'css-font-awesome' => '',
'css-highlightjs' => '',
'js-ace' => '',
'js-bootstrap' => '',
'js-dropzone' => '',
'js-jquery' => '',
'js-jquery-datatables' => '',
'js-highlightjs' => '',
'pre-jsdelivr' => '',
'pre-cloudflare' => ''
);
// --- EDIT BELOW CAREFULLY OR DO NOT EDIT AT ALL ---
// max upload file size
define('MAX_UPLOAD_SIZE', $max_upload_size_bytes);
// upload chunk size
define('UPLOAD_CHUNK_SIZE', $upload_chunk_size_bytes);
// private key and session name to store to the session
if ( !defined( 'FM_SESSION_ID')) {
define('FM_SESSION_ID', 'filemanager');
}
// Configuration
$cfg = new FM_Config();
// Default language
$lang = isset($cfg->data['lang']) ? $cfg->data['lang'] : 'en';
// Show or hide files and folders that starts with a dot
$show_hidden_files = isset($cfg->data['show_hidden']) ? $cfg->data['show_hidden'] : true;
// PHP error reporting - false = Turns off Errors, true = Turns on Errors
$report_errors = isset($cfg->data['error_reporting']) ? $cfg->data['error_reporting'] : true;
// Hide Permissions and Owner cols in file-listing
$hide_Cols = isset($cfg->data['hide_Cols']) ? $cfg->data['hide_Cols'] : true;
// Theme
$theme = isset($cfg->data['theme']) ? $cfg->data['theme'] : 'light';
define('FM_THEME', $theme);
//available languages
$lang_list = array(
'en' => 'English'
);
if ($report_errors == true) {
@ini_set('error_reporting', E_ALL);
@ini_set('display_errors', 1);
} else {
@ini_set('error_reporting', E_ALL);
@ini_set('display_errors', 0);
}
// if fm included
if (defined('FM_EMBED')) {
$use_auth = false;
$sticky_navbar = false;
} else {
@set_time_limit(600);
date_default_timezone_set($default_timezone);
ini_set('default_charset', 'UTF-8');
if (version_compare(PHP_VERSION, '5.6.0', '<') && function_exists('mb_internal_encoding')) {
mb_internal_encoding('UTF-8');
}
if (function_exists('mb_regex_encoding')) {
mb_regex_encoding('UTF-8');
}
session_cache_limiter('nocache'); // Prevent logout issue after page was cached
session_name(FM_SESSION_ID );
function session_error_handling_function($code, $msg, $file, $line) {
// Permission denied for default session, try to create a new one
if ($code == 2) {
session_abort();
session_id(session_create_id());
@session_start();
}
}
set_error_handler('session_error_handling_function');
session_start();
restore_error_handler();
}
//Generating CSRF Token
if (empty($_SESSION['token'])) {
if (function_exists('random_bytes')) {
$_SESSION['token'] = bin2hex(random_bytes(32));
} else {
$_SESSION['token'] = bin2hex(openssl_random_pseudo_bytes(32));
}
}
if (empty($auth_users)) {
$use_auth = false;
}
$is_https = isset($_SERVER['HTTPS']) && ($_SERVER['HTTPS'] == 'on' || $_SERVER['HTTPS'] == 1)
|| isset($_SERVER['HTTP_X_FORWARDED_PROTO']) && $_SERVER['HTTP_X_FORWARDED_PROTO'] == 'https';
// update $root_url based on user specific directories
if (isset($_SESSION[FM_SESSION_ID]['logged']) && !empty($directories_users[$_SESSION[FM_SESSION_ID]['logged']])) {
$wd = fm_clean_path(dirname($_SERVER['PHP_SELF']));
$root_url = $root_url.$wd.DIRECTORY_SEPARATOR.$directories_users[$_SESSION[FM_SESSION_ID]['logged']];
}
// clean $root_url
$root_url = fm_clean_path($root_url);
// abs path for site
defined('FM_ROOT_URL') || define('FM_ROOT_URL', ($is_https ? 'https' : 'http') . '://' . $http_host . (!empty($root_url) ? '/' . $root_url : ''));
defined('FM_SELF_URL') || define('FM_SELF_URL', ($is_https ? 'https' : 'http') . '://' . $http_host . $_SERVER['PHP_SELF']);
// logout
if (isset($_GET['logout'])) {
unset($_SESSION[FM_SESSION_ID]['logged']);
unset( $_SESSION['token']);
fm_redirect(FM_SELF_URL);
}
// Validate connection IP
if ($ip_ruleset != 'OFF') {
function getClientIP() {
if (array_key_exists('HTTP_CF_CONNECTING_IP', $_SERVER)) {
return $_SERVER["HTTP_CF_CONNECTING_IP"];
}else if (array_key_exists('HTTP_X_FORWARDED_FOR', $_SERVER)) {
return $_SERVER["HTTP_X_FORWARDED_FOR"];
}else if (array_key_exists('REMOTE_ADDR', $_SERVER)) {
return $_SERVER['REMOTE_ADDR'];
}else if (array_key_exists('HTTP_CLIENT_IP', $_SERVER)) {
return $_SERVER['HTTP_CLIENT_IP'];
}
return '';
}
$clientIp = getClientIP();
$proceed = false;
$whitelisted = in_array($clientIp, $ip_whitelist);
$blacklisted = in_array($clientIp, $ip_blacklist);
if($ip_ruleset == 'AND'){
if($whitelisted == true && $blacklisted == false){
$proceed = true;
}
} else
if($ip_ruleset == 'OR'){
if($whitelisted == true || $blacklisted == false){
$proceed = true;
}
}
if($proceed == false){
trigger_error('User connection denied from: ' . $clientIp, E_USER_WARNING);
if($ip_silent == false){
fm_set_msg(lng('Access denied. IP restriction applicable'), 'error');
fm_show_header_login();
fm_show_message();
}
exit();
}
}
// Checking if the user is logged in or not. If not, it will show the login form.
if ($use_auth) {
if (isset($_SESSION[FM_SESSION_ID]['logged'], $auth_users[$_SESSION[FM_SESSION_ID]['logged']])) {
// Logged
} elseif (isset($_POST['fm_usr'], $_POST['fm_pwd'], $_POST['token'])) {
// Logging In
sleep(1);
if(function_exists('password_verify')) {
if (isset($auth_users[$_POST['fm_usr']]) && isset($_POST['fm_pwd']) && password_verify($_POST['fm_pwd'], $auth_users[$_POST['fm_usr']]) && verifyToken($_POST['token'])) {
$_SESSION[FM_SESSION_ID]['logged'] = $_POST['fm_usr'];
fm_set_msg(lng('You are logged in'));
fm_redirect(FM_SELF_URL);
} else {
unset($_SESSION[FM_SESSION_ID]['logged']);
fm_set_msg(lng('Login failed. Invalid username or password'), 'error');
fm_redirect(FM_SELF_URL);
}
} else {
fm_set_msg(lng('password_hash not supported, Upgrade PHP version'), 'error');;
}
} else {
// Form
unset($_SESSION[FM_SESSION_ID]['logged']);
fm_show_header_login();
?>
However, should you decide victory anything ample, you won’t ever need to put. Talking about slot machines that enable you to wager of Bien au 0.1 for each and critical link every range, very 5 is enough to own five hundred revolves. Because of this people can get simply an excellent games having astonishing picture, fascinating gameplay and you will a fair RNG one assures equity of play. You can place bets on the a new player, a distributor, or a blow. An element of the objective would be to assemble a mixture of notes with a total get of 9 or as close that you can to help you 9 playing with two or three cards.
PayPalSkrillPlayStar10The welcome render in the PlayStar try nice, having to five-hundred totally free revolves and you may 500 within the added bonus cash that have deposit suits in your first about three deals.
5 minimal put casinos inside NZ provide their customers with a obvious level of pros, which makes for each and every video game much more lovely.
For those who join at any betting program, you might found big offers and you can respect advantages.
You’ll see this type of indexed alongside the incentive offers to your all of our web site.
Some casinos offer no-wagering bonuses, while others give incentives that need no dumps. Probably one of the most fascinating features of your own on-line casino globe is the matter and kind of incentives and you may advertisements which might be offered. Never assume all casinos is worth believe, so we look at all the bonus terms and conditions, and also the credentials of one’s gambling enterprises that offer them. I make available to you among the better also provides available on the web and you can give an explanation for terms in more detail so you can make an educated possibilities. Iris’s five years of experience as the a manager of one’s live specialist floors from casinos on the internet have demostrated the girl warmth to the world.
Critical link – Banking Steps
Usually entering an advantage password is as simple as copying and you will pasting the brand new password to your required profession within the join techniques. Incentive rules aren’t required after all web based casinos, but once he is, they serve to unlock the fresh local casino incentive and possess put an excellent little thrill for the registration process. Bonus codes are usually made up of characters, quantity or terminology. Ahead of publishing recommending a no deposit Casino Bonus, all of us out of professionals reaches works splitting up a knowledgeable and you can most reputable casinos on the internet on the not-so-credible of these. Very online participants seek out signed up and you may authoritative casinos offering legitimate, No deposit Bonuses. This type of casinos should also render a large type of video game, safe financial options, and you may a casual customer service team.
Better Playing Also offers To possess Existing Consumers In the February 2024
All of the betting blogs on the Nj.com is created only by the Catena Mass media, that gives expert study, ratings, incentives, and you may products to own sports gamblers and you may casino players. A decreased you’ll have the ability to make are step 1, even though, 5 is usually the lower amount one to an online local casino usually query of you. Harbors Heaven is actually an online casino that gives tons to have gamblers as opposed to you needing to break your budget to start a free account. Go to your website now to find out why it’s such a premier local casino. There are the fresh betting conditions of every gambling enterprise added bonus by the examining the brand new T&Cs. Situations is also happen where participants need the assistance of help staff.
What Percentage Actions Can i Have fun with During the A 5 Put Gambling enterprise?
The average gambling establishment RTP of 96.5percent would not be alarming for individuals who compare to an informed payout Canada gambling enterprises. Although not, 7Bit has some slot game that you will not be able to come across someplace else. The step 1 money put local casino picks have a large range from game for all preferences. I authored genuine athlete membership at each step one money put gambling establishment in this article, and thirty-six anybody else i left out because they didn’t satisfy our very own requirements. Our very own definitions for each and every required incentive permit you in order to find each type of just one deposit local casino extra. Contrast the brand new also offers in this post that have Canada’s finest indication-right up bonuses to possess a complete take a look at.
The very least put local casino is exactly what is actually states to your tin — it’s a casino webpages you to definitely allows lowest places. The actual deposit number depends on the new local casino, but there are 5 deposit gambling enterprises, step 3 lowest deposit gambling enterprises, and also 1 put gambling enterprises for you to appreciate. Are you looking for an internet local casino that will offer your complete use of astronomical gains? Established in 1998, Fortunate Nugget understands the newest particulars of the brand new iGaming community. For many who search advantages and you can immersion throughout the gameplay, Lucky Nugget’s online game reception from five hundred+ headings from best-notch app company would be to tickle your own attention. Best says are Charge card, Skrill, Paysafecard, and you will Neteller.
Simply fulfill the affixed 200x betting requirements earliest ahead of saying any payouts. You should fulfill a highly doable 40x wagering conditions ahead of requesting earnings. BetMGM is yet another popular local casino in the us that delivers consumers the newest Vegas experience whenever to experience casino games. In the BetMGM, you can enjoy certain games from roulette, web based poker, blackjack, baccarat and you may slots. While we’ll talk about within this review, people is generally entitled to redeem a pleasant or present incentive when they deposit in their local casino account.
Best Gambling enterprises United states of america
If you are a wordpress member which have administrative privileges about this site, please enter your email on the container lower than and then click “Send”. You’ll then discovered a message that assists your win back access. For this reason, constantly investigate incentive terms and conditions one or more times. Improve 5 deposit, as well as the added bonus will be placed into your balance. Players should do the lookup and select authorized and you may regulated casinos which have a great reputations to be sure the protection.
Professionals As well as Liked
At the same time, it has been certified by eCOGRA, and that claims that the video game are fair along with your information that is personal is actually leftover safer. In comparison to other gambling enterprise offers, the new “deposit 5, play with 80” deal stands out as the a premier choices. So it venture allows you to get up to help you 80 free which have simply a 5 basic payment. So, the best offer your’ll come across at any playing web site is the 5 min deposit casino to get a great 80 totally free play extra. That it, although not, as well as means these bonuses are tough to come by. Another trick advantageous asset of to play from the ten put gambling enterprises is that an excellent 10 put often qualifies to own a bonus.